We've got a range of quality transportable buildings ready to go, located in South Australia. Whether you need a site office, crew amenities, or a compact workspace β we've got you covered.
β‘οΈ 7m x 3m Crib Room with Toilet
A complete amenities solution featuring open-plan crib/lunchroom, integrated toilet, kitchenette, sink, cabinetry, and zip boiler. Ideal for construction sites and remote operations. Available for purchase or short/long-term hire.

Proud to share the completion of four modular residential dwellings for the Housing Authority of Western Australia β delivered to Wyndham, in the heart of the Kimberley.
Remote housing projects don't come without their challenges, and this one had plenty. Here's what it took to get four quality homes across the line.
π·4 dwellings across 2 lots β one 2-bedroom and one 3-bedroom on each
π·Designed, engineered, and certified to NCC, built specifically for Kimberley conditions
π·Manufactured at our Darwin facility and transported over 2,000 km by road to Wyndham
π·Cranage, structural assembly, and full site completion managed on arrival
π·Local Wyndham and regional contractors engaged for plumbing, electrical, and civil works
π·Site materials and landscaping sourced locally
π·External works completed including fencing, driveways, carports, gates, and landscaping
